Προσθήκη φύλλου εργασίας σε υπάρχον Βιβλίο εργασίας του Excel C# Tutorial
Εισαγωγή
Στο σύγχρονο ψηφιακό τοπίο με γρήγορο ρυθμό, η ικανότητα αποτελεσματικής διαχείρισης δεδομένων είναι ζωτικής σημασίας για κάθε επιχείρηση. Τα υπολογιστικά φύλλα του Excel είναι ο ακρογωνιαίος λίθος της διαχείρισης δεδομένων και η αυτοματοποίηση εργασιών σε αυτά μπορεί να εξοικονομήσει σημαντικό χρόνο και προσπάθεια. Σε αυτόν τον οδηγό, θα διερευνήσουμε πώς να προσθέσετε μέσω προγραμματισμού ένα φύλλο εργασίας σε ένα υπάρχον βιβλίο εργασίας του Excel χρησιμοποιώντας το Aspose.Cells για .NET, μια ισχυρή βιβλιοθήκη σχεδιασμένη για απρόσκοπτη επεξεργασία υπολογιστικών φύλλων. Ας ξεκινήσουμε!
Προαπαιτούμενα
Πριν βουτήξουμε στον κώδικα, βεβαιωθείτε ότι διαθέτετε τα ακόλουθα εργαλεία και γνώσεις:
- Visual Studio: Κατεβάστε και εγκαταστήστε το Visual Studio απόεδώ.
- Aspose.Cells για .NET: Ενσωματώστε τα Aspose.Cells στο έργο σας. Μπορείτε να το κατεβάσετε από τοτοποθεσία.
- Βασικές γνώσεις C#: Η εξοικείωση με την C# θα σας βοηθήσει να ακολουθήσετε. Μην ανησυχείτε αν είστε νέος. θα σας καθοδηγήσουμε σε κάθε βήμα!
- Κατάλογος εγγράφων: Δημιουργήστε έναν φάκελο στον υπολογιστή σας για να αποθηκεύσετε τα αρχεία Excel για αυτό το σεμινάριο.
Αφού ρυθμίσετε τα πάντα, ας εισάγουμε τα απαραίτητα πακέτα.
Εισαγωγή απαιτούμενων πακέτων
Για να ξεκινήσουμε, πρέπει να εισαγάγουμε βασικούς χώρους ονομάτων από τη βιβλιοθήκη Aspose.Cells. Δείτε πώς:
using System.IO;
using Aspose.Cells;
ΟSystem.IO
Ο χώρος ονομάτων θα μας βοηθήσει να διαχειριστούμε τις λειτουργίες αρχείων, ενώAspose.Cells
παρέχει τη λειτουργικότητα που απαιτείται για τη διαχείριση του Excel. Τώρα, ας ρυθμίσουμε τον κατάλογο εγγράφων μας.
Βήμα 1: Καθορίστε τη διαδρομή του καταλόγου εγγράφων
Αρχικά, καθορίστε πού θα αποθηκευτούν τα αρχεία σας Excel. Αυτό είναι ζωτικής σημασίας για την πρόσβαση στα αρχεία με τα οποία θέλετε να εργαστείτε.
// Η διαδρομή προς τον κατάλογο εγγράφων.
string dataDir = "YOUR DOCUMENT DIRECTORY";
ΑντικαθιστώYOUR DOCUMENT DIRECTORY
με την πραγματική διαδρομή προς το φάκελό σας που περιέχει τα αρχεία Excel.
Βήμα 2: Δημιουργήστε μια ροή αρχείων για να ανοίξετε το βιβλίο εργασίας
Στη συνέχεια, θα δημιουργήσουμε μια ροή αρχείων για να ανοίξουμε το υπάρχον βιβλίο εργασίας του Excel.
// Δημιουργία ροής αρχείων για άνοιγμα του αρχείου Excel
FileStream fstream = new FileStream(dataDir + "book1.xls", FileMode.Open);
Συγουρεύομαιbook1.xls
υπάρχει στον καθορισμένο κατάλογο σας. Διαφορετικά, αυτό το βήμα θα οδηγήσει σε σφάλμα.
Βήμα 3: Δημιουργήστε ένα αντικείμενο βιβλίου εργασίας
Τώρα, ας δημιουργήσουμε ένα παράδειγμα τουWorkbook
τάξη για να κρατήσει το αρχείο μας Excel.
// Δημιουργία αντικειμένου βιβλίου εργασίας
Workbook workbook = new Workbook(fstream);
Αυτή η περίπτωση μας επιτρέπει να χειριζόμαστε τα περιεχόμενα του αρχείου Excel μέσω προγραμματισμού.
Βήμα 4: Προσθέστε ένα νέο φύλλο εργασίας
Τώρα για το συναρπαστικό μέρος—προσθέτοντας ένα νέο φύλλο εργασίας στο βιβλίο εργασίας μας!
// Προσθήκη νέου φύλλου εργασίας στο αντικείμενο του βιβλίου εργασίας
int i = workbook.Worksheets.Add();
Αυτή η γραμμή προσθέτει ένα νέο φύλλο εργασίας και το ευρετήριο αυτού του νέου φύλλου αποθηκεύεται στη μεταβλητήi
.
Βήμα 5: Ανατρέξτε στο Φύλλο εργασίας που προστέθηκε πρόσφατα
Μόλις δημιουργηθεί το νέο φύλλο εργασίας, πρέπει να λάβουμε μια αναφορά σε αυτό για περαιτέρω προσαρμογή.
// Λήψη αναφοράς στο φύλλο εργασίας που προστέθηκε πρόσφατα
Worksheet worksheet = workbook.Worksheets[i];
Τώρα μπορούμε να χειριστούμε τις ιδιότητες του νέου μας φύλλου εργασίας.
Βήμα 6: Ορίστε το όνομα του νέου φύλλου εργασίας
Ας δώσουμε στο πρόσφατα προστιθέμενο φύλλο εργασίας μας ένα ουσιαστικό όνομα!
// Ρύθμιση του ονόματος του φύλλου εργασίας που προστέθηκε πρόσφατα
worksheet.Name = "My Worksheet";
Μη διστάσετε να αλλάξετε"My Worksheet"
σε όποιο όνομα ταιριάζει στις ανάγκες σας.
Βήμα 7: Αποθηκεύστε το Αρχείο Excel
Με την ολοκλήρωση των τροποποιήσεών μας, ήρθε η ώρα να αποθηκεύσετε το βιβλίο εργασίας.
// Αποθήκευση του αρχείου Excel
workbook.Save(dataDir + "output.out.xls");
Εδώ, αποθηκεύουμε το βιβλίο εργασίας ωςoutput.out.xls
. Μπορείτε να επιλέξετε όποιο όνομα προτιμάτε.
Βήμα 8: Κλείστε τη ροή αρχείων
Τέλος, θα πρέπει να κλείσουμε τη ροή αρχείων για να ελευθερώσουμε πόρους.
// Κλείσιμο της ροής αρχείων για να ελευθερωθούν όλοι οι πόροι
fstream.Close();
Αυτό διασφαλίζει ότι διατηρούμε ένα καθαρό και αποτελεσματικό περιβάλλον.
Σύναψη
Συγχαρητήρια! Προσθέσατε με επιτυχία ένα νέο φύλλο εργασίας σε ένα υπάρχον βιβλίο εργασίας του Excel χρησιμοποιώντας το Aspose.Cells για .NET. Ακολουθώντας αυτά τα απλά βήματα, μπορείτε να βελτιώσετε την παραγωγικότητά σας και να βελτιστοποιήσετε τις εργασίες διαχείρισης δεδομένων σας.
Η κατανόηση του τρόπου χειρισμού αρχείων Excel μέσω προγραμματισμού ανοίγει έναν κόσμο δυνατοτήτων—είτε διαχειρίζεστε μεγάλα σύνολα δεδομένων είτε δημιουργείτε λεπτομερείς αναφορές. Λοιπόν, τι περιμένετε; Ξεκινήστε την αυτοματοποίηση των υπολογιστικών φύλλων σας σήμερα!
Συχνές ερωτήσεις
Τι είναι το Aspose.Cells;
Το Aspose.Cells είναι μια ισχυρή βιβλιοθήκη που επιτρέπει στους προγραμματιστές να δημιουργούν, να επεξεργάζονται και να διαχειρίζονται αρχεία Excel εντός εφαρμογών .NET, χωρίς να απαιτείται Microsoft Excel.
Είναι το Aspose.Cells δωρεάν;
Το Aspose.Cells προσφέρει μια δωρεάν δοκιμή στους χρήστες για να δοκιμάσουν τις δυνατότητές του πριν από την αγορά. Μπορείτε να το κατεβάσετεεδώ.
Μπορώ να χρησιμοποιήσω το Aspose.Cells σε Linux;
Ναι, το Aspose.Cells για .NET είναι συμβατό με .NET Core, επιτρέποντάς σας να εκτελείτε εφαρμογές σε Linux.
Πού μπορώ να βρω υποστήριξη για το Aspose.Cells;
Μπορείτε να βρείτε υποστήριξη και να κάνετε ερωτήσεις στοAspose forum υποστήριξης.
Πώς μπορώ να αποκτήσω μια προσωρινή άδεια για το Aspose.Cells;
Ζητήστε μια προσωρινή άδεια από τον ιστότοπο της Asposeεδώ.